Effect of compound salvae-dropping-pill on intracellular free calcium concentration of cultured rat myocardial cells in case of hypoxia and reoxygenation / 中国病理生理杂志

ABSTRACT

AIM:

To examine the effect of compound salvae-dropping-pill (CSDP) on intracellular free calcium in cultured rat myocardial cells subjected to hypoxia and reoxygenation.

METHODS:

The Fluo- 3/AM was applied to probe intracellular calcium concentration and the fluorescent intensity was detected using laser confocal microscopy technique.

RESULTS:

Fluorescent intensity in hypoxia plus CSDP group was significantly lower (1 217 78?312 07) than that of hypoxia group (1 509?508 48), and the Fluorescent intensity of hypoxia/reoxygenation plus CSDP group was also markedly lower (1 567.91?577 61) than that of hypoxia/reoxygenation group (1 617.60?477.53).

CONCLUSION:

The cultured rat myocardial cells could be effectively protected by administration of CSDP in case of hypoxia and reoxygenation through decreasing the intracellular calcium concentration. [
